    Hi,

    If it's short rodent hair then it really isn't a problem - but long human hair definately can be. :(

    I once saw a baby iguana die because the boss's wife in the shop got some of her hair in the iguana food and it tangled up the intestines or caused a blockage. You could actually see about 3 inches of it hanging out of the poor thing ( she had very long hair at the time ).

    It wasn't until we found one dead the next day we looked at the food and discovered the hairs.
